JOB OVERVIEW:
Under the general guidance of the Room Service Manager the Room Service Supervisor is responsible for overseeing the daily operations of the hotels in-room dining services. This role ensures prompt courteous and professional service to guests maintaining the highest standards of quality and presentation. The Room Service Supervisor leads a dedicated team coordinates with kitchen and housekeeping departments and addresses guest inquiries and special requests to deliver an exceptional dining experience in the comfort of guest rooms.
YOUR K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Supervise and coordinate daily operations of the room service team to ensure timely and accurate delivery of food and beverages.
- Train mentor and support room service staff to maintain high standards of service quality and guest satisfaction.
- Monitor guest orders to ensure accuracy presentation standards and adherence to hotel policies.
- Handle guest complaints or special requests efficiently and professionally to ensure a positive experience.
- Conduct daily briefings and assign duties to room service attendants based on business levels.
- Ensure cleanliness and hygiene of service areas and equipment in accordance with health and safety regulations.
- Maintain proper inventory of room service supplies and coordinate with the kitchen and housekeeping departments as needed.
- Prepare shift reports and assist in scheduling staff to meet operational needs.
- Monitor compliance with hotel policies procedures and service standards.
- Support management in implementing new initiatives to enhance the in-room dining experience.
